Claims
- 1. A sheet feeding device for feeding sheets, one by one, from a stack of sheets, said device comprising:
- sheet separating means for attracting and holding an uppermost sheet of a stack of sheets, thereby withdrawing said uppermost sheet from the stacked sheets, said sheet separating means being swingable through a given angular range;
- delivering means for receiving said uppermost sheet from said sheet separating means and for delivering said uppermost sheet to a succeeding station, said delivering means comprising a drum, a first belt and a second belt each in contact with said drum and drive means for driving said drum, wherein said drum and said first and second belts rotate in a first direction to roll in said sheet therebetween, and then said drum and said second belt rotate in a second direction to roll out said sheet to deliver said sheet to the succeeding station;
- a drive source for activating said delivering means;
- control means having a memory for storing data relating to a plurality of nominal sheet conveying speeds of said succeeding station, and a control circuit coupled to said drive source so as to control the rotational speed of said drive source; and
- means for selecting said stored nominal sheet conveying speeds from said memory.
- 2. A sheet feeding device according to claim 1, wherein said selecting means is a dip switch.
- 3. A sheet feeding device according to claim 1, further including means for fine-adjusting said nominal sheet conveying speed selected by said selecting means.
- 4. A sheet feeding device according to claim 3, wherein said fine-adjusting means is at least one dip switch.
- 5. A sheet feeding device for feeding sheets, one by one, from a stack of sheets, said device comprising:
- sheet separating means for attracting and holding an uppermost sheet of a stack of sheets, thereby withdrawing said uppermost sheet from the stacked sheets, said sheet separating means being swingable through a given angular range;
- delivering means for receiving said uppermost sheet from said sheet separating means and for delivering said uppermost sheet to a succeeding station, said delivering means comprising a drum, a first belt and a second belt each in contact with said drum, a first detecting means for detecting the leading end of said sheet, a second detecting means for detecting the trailing end of said sheet and drive means for driving said drum, wherein said first and second belts transport said sheet in a first direction at a first speed in response to the first detecting signal by said first detecting means, and then said second belt transports said sheet in a second direction at a second speed, which is different from said first speed, in response to the second detecting signal by said second detecting means;
- a drive source for activating said delivering means;
- control means having a memory for storing data relating to a plurality of nominal sheet conveying speeds of said succeeding station, and a control circuit coupled to said drive source so as to control the rotational speed of said drive source; and
- means for selecting said stored nominal sheet conveying speeds as said first and second speeds from said memory.
